dc.description.abstractThis study was made t o determine the reasons for the decline of the Wisconsin Interscholastic Athletic Association (WIAA) volleyball program. A questionnaire was sent to one hundred thirty-six schools (still in existence) t h a t sponsored volleyball during its peak years, 1958-59 and 1959-60, and t o the thirty-eight schools t h a t participated i n the 1969 WIAA Valleyball Tournament. The questionnaire was returned by one hundred sixteen of the schools that sponsored volleyball during its peak years and by all thirty-eight of the 1969 volleyball schools.en
